Output ed1f5c6f99eaa1b1ad95cdf307489f56ce7fd51ce52c911fb13b1e5eba2b314c:3

value
88308905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b30eb6b9761798c34a3fcbd19e4162194798cdd8 OP_EQUAL
address
3J1nWDF2HxLkXFqSDGUvrD7T93aAyiRwoZ
transaction
ed1f5c6f99eaa1b1ad95cdf307489f56ce7fd51ce52c911fb13b1e5eba2b314c
confirmations
284544
spent
true